#include <QtGui>#include "bronzestyle.h"void BronzeStyle::polish(QPalette &palette){ QPixmap backgroundImage(":/images/background.png"); QColor bronze(207, 155, 95); QColor veryLightBlue(239, 239, 247); QColor lightBlue(223, 223, 239); QColor darkBlue(95, 95, 191); palette = QPalette(bronze); palette.setBrush(QPalette::Window, backgroundImage); palette.setBrush(QPalette::BrightText, Qt::white); palette.setBrush(QPalette::Base, veryLightBlue); palette.setBrush(QPalette::AlternateBase, lightBlue); palette.setBrush(QPalette::Highlight, darkBlue); palette.setBrush(QPalette::Disabled, QPalette::Highlight, Qt::darkGray);}void BronzeStyle::polish(QWidget *widget){ if (qobject_cast<QAbstractButton *>(widget) || qobject_cast<QAbstractSpinBox *>(widget)) widget->setAttribute(Qt::WA_Hover, true);}void BronzeStyle::unpolish(QWidget *widget){ if (qobject_cast<QAbstractButton *>(widget) || qobject_cast<QAbstractSpinBox *>(widget)) widget->setAttribute(Qt::WA_Hover, false);}int BronzeStyle::styleHint(StyleHint which, const QStyleOption *option, const QWidget *widget, QStyleHintReturn *returnData) const{ switch (which) { case SH_DialogButtonLayout: return int(QDialogButtonBox::MacLayout); case SH_EtchDisabledText: return int(true); case SH_DialogButtonBox_ButtonsHaveIcons: return int(true); case SH_UnderlineShortcut: return int(false); default: return QWindowsStyle::styleHint(which, option, widget, returnData); }}int BronzeStyle::pixelMetric(PixelMetric which, const QStyleOption *option, const QWidget *widget) const{ switch (which) { case PM_ButtonDefaultIndicator: return 0; case PM_IndicatorWidth: case PM_IndicatorHeight: return 16; case PM_CheckBoxLabelSpacing: return 8; case PM_DefaultFrameWidth: return 2; default: return QWindowsStyle::pixelMetric(which, option, widget); }}void BronzeStyle::drawPrimitive(PrimitiveElement which, const QStyleOption *option, QPainter *painter, const QWidget *widget) const{ switch (which) { case PE_IndicatorCheckBox: drawBronzeCheckBoxIndicator(option, painter); break; case PE_PanelButtonCommand: drawBronzeBevel(option, painter); break; case PE_Frame: drawBronzeFrame(option, painter); break; case PE_FrameDefaultButton: break; default: QWindowsStyle::drawPrimitive(which, option, painter, widget); }}void BronzeStyle::drawComplexControl(ComplexControl which, const QStyleOptionComplex *option, QPainter *painter, const QWidget *widget) const{ if (which == CC_SpinBox) { drawBronzeSpinBoxButton(SC_SpinBoxDown, option, painter); drawBronzeSpinBoxButton(SC_SpinBoxUp, option, painter); QRect rect = subControlRect(CC_SpinBox, option, SC_SpinBoxEditField) .adjusted(-1, 0, +1, 0); painter->setPen(QPen(option->palette.mid(), 1.0)); painter->drawLine(rect.topLeft(), rect.bottomLeft()); painter->drawLine(rect.topRight(), rect.bottomRight()); } else { return QWindowsStyle::drawComplexControl(which, option, painter, widget); }}QRect BronzeStyle::subControlRect(ComplexControl whichControl, const QStyleOptionComplex *option, SubControl whichSubControl, const QWidget *widget) const{ if (whichControl == CC_SpinBox) { int frameWidth = pixelMetric(PM_DefaultFrameWidth, option, widget); int buttonWidth = 16; switch (whichSubControl) { case SC_SpinBoxFrame: return option->rect; case SC_SpinBoxEditField: return option->rect.adjusted(+buttonWidth, +frameWidth, -buttonWidth, -frameWidth); case SC_SpinBoxDown: return visualRect(option->direction, option->rect, QRect(option->rect.x(), option->rect.y(), buttonWidth, option->rect.height())); case SC_SpinBoxUp: return visualRect(option->direction, option->rect, QRect(option->rect.right() - buttonWidth, option->rect.y(), buttonWidth, option->rect.height())); default: return QRect(); } } else { return QWindowsStyle::subControlRect(whichControl, option, whichSubControl, widget); }}QIcon BronzeStyle::standardIconImplementation(StandardPixmap which, const QStyleOption *option, const QWidget *widget) const{ QImage image = QWindowsStyle::standardPixmap(which, option, widget) .toImage(); if (image.isNull()) return QIcon(); QPalette palette; if (option) { palette = option->palette; } else if (widget) { palette = widget->palette(); } QPainter painter(&image); painter.setOpacity(0.25); painter.setCompositionMode(QPainter::CompositionMode_SourceAtop); painter.fillRect(image.rect(), palette.highlight()); painter.end(); return QIcon(QPixmap::fromImage(image));}void BronzeStyle::drawBronzeFrame(const QStyleOption *option, QPainter *painter) const{ painter->save(); painter->setRenderHint(QPainter::Antialiasing, true); painter->setPen(QPen(option->palette.foreground(), 1.0)); painter->drawRect(option->rect.adjusted(+1, +1, -1, -1)); painter->restore();}void BronzeStyle::drawBronzeBevel(const QStyleOption *option, QPainter *painter) const{ QColor buttonColor = option->palette.button().color(); int coeff = (option->state & State_MouseOver) ? 115 : 105; QLinearGradient gradient(0, 0, 0, option->rect.height()); gradient.setColorAt(0.0, option->palette.light().color()); gradient.setColorAt(0.2, buttonColor.lighter(coeff)); gradient.setColorAt(0.8, buttonColor.darker(coeff)); gradient.setColorAt(1.0, option->palette.dark().color()); double penWidth = 1.0; if (const QStyleOptionButton *buttonOpt = qstyleoption_cast<const QStyleOptionButton *>(option)) { if (buttonOpt->features & QStyleOptionButton::DefaultButton) penWidth = 2.0; } QRect roundRect = option->rect.adjusted(+1, +1, -1, -1); if (!roundRect.isValid()) return; int diameter = 12; int cx = 100 * diameter / roundRect.width(); int cy = 100 * diameter / roundRect.height(); painter->save(); painter->setPen(Qt::NoPen); painter->setBrush(gradient); painter->drawRoundRect(roundRect, cx, cy); if (option->state & (State_On | State_Sunken)) { QColor slightlyOpaqueBlack(0, 0, 0, 63); painter->setBrush(slightlyOpaqueBlack); painter->drawRoundRect(roundRect, cx, cy); } painter->setRenderHint(QPainter::Antialiasing, true); painter->setPen(QPen(option->palette.foreground(), penWidth)); painter->setBrush(Qt::NoBrush); painter->drawRoundRect(roundRect, cx, cy); painter->restore();}void BronzeStyle::drawBronzeCheckBoxIndicator( const QStyleOption *option, QPainter *painter) const{ painter->save(); painter->setRenderHint(QPainter::Antialiasing, true); if (option->state & State_MouseOver) { painter->setBrush(option->palette.alternateBase()); } else { painter->setBrush(option->palette.base()); } painter->drawRoundRect(option->rect.adjusted(+1, +1, -1, -1)); if (option->state & (State_On | State_NoChange)) { QPixmap pixmap; if (!(option->state & State_Enabled)) { pixmap.load(":/images/checkmark-disabled.png"); } else if (option->state & State_NoChange) { pixmap.load(":/images/checkmark-partial.png"); } else { pixmap.load(":/images/checkmark.png"); } QRect pixmapRect = pixmap.rect() .translated(option->rect.topLeft()) .translated(+2, -6); QRect painterRect = visualRect(option->direction, option->rect, pixmapRect); if (option->direction == Qt::RightToLeft) { painter->scale(-1.0, +1.0); painterRect.moveLeft(-painterRect.right() - 1); } painter->drawPixmap(painterRect, pixmap); } painter->restore();}void BronzeStyle::drawBronzeSpinBoxButton(SubControl which, const QStyleOptionComplex *option, QPainter *painter) const{ PrimitiveElement arrow = PE_IndicatorArrowLeft; QRect buttonRect = option->rect; if ((which == SC_SpinBoxUp) != (option->direction == Qt::RightToLeft)) { arrow = PE_IndicatorArrowRight; buttonRect.translate(buttonRect.width() / 2, 0); } buttonRect.setWidth((buttonRect.width() + 1) / 2); QStyleOption buttonOpt(*option); painter->save(); painter->setClipRect(buttonRect, Qt::IntersectClip); if (!(option->activeSubControls & which)) buttonOpt.state &= ~(State_MouseOver | State_On | State_Sunken); drawBronzeBevel(&buttonOpt, painter); QStyleOption arrowOpt(buttonOpt); arrowOpt.rect = subControlRect(CC_SpinBox, option, which) .adjusted(+3, +3, -3, -3); if (arrowOpt.rect.isValid()) drawPrimitive(arrow, &arrowOpt, painter); painter->restore();}
